libs/common/src/key-management/pin/pin-lock-type.ts
Normal file
7
libs/common/src/key-management/pin/pin-lock-type.ts
Normal file
@@ -0,0 +1,7 @@
|
||||
/**
|
||||
* - DISABLED : No PIN set.
|
||||
* - PERSISTENT : PIN is set and persists through client reset.
|
||||
* - EPHEMERAL : PIN is set, but does NOT persist through client reset. This means that
|
||||
* after client reset the master password is required to unlock.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
export type PinLockType = "DISABLED" | "PERSISTENT" | "EPHEMERAL";
